A member asked:

Is biting nails is a phsycological problem?

3 doctors weighed in across 2 answers
Dr. Johanna Fricke answered

Specializes in Pediatrics - Developmental and Behavioral

Chronic nail-biting : Is, indeed, a habit disorder most commonly found in children & adults with anxiety disorders +/- other comorbid conditions (e.g., adhd). Accurate diagnoses by mental health professionals are needed to determine which treatments & therapies are most likely to be effective in managing the symptoms.

Dr. Heidi Fowler answered

Specializes in Psychiatry

Sometimes: Nail biting can be a form of obsessive compulsive disorder (OCD) that is treatable with cognitive behavioral therapy, behavioral therapy and sometimes psychotropic medications.
